Farming cataloged research

Obtaining Cataloged Research is one of the most important currencies in WoW. It is needed for a variety of upgrades, including Korthian gear, conduit upgrades, and purchase of useful must-have items. In addition, it is required to progress through the Archivist’s Codex reputation system. This reputation system rewards reputation for turning in common quality items. It can be gotten by doing quests, killing rares, and collecting treasures. Currently, there is no cap on the amount of Cataloged Research that can be accumulated. In a recent hotfix, the cap was removed, but the currency remains slow to obtain.
